RLCD makes it easy to control small embedded devices from Android. It provides a simulated LCD that devices control wirelessly to display a simple text-based UI. RLCD sends touches on the LCD to the embedded device enabling interactive UIs. Thus small faceless resource-constrained devices can have a dynamic interactive "app" on mobile devices.

The Remote LCD protocol is simple and open allowing simulated display implementations on other mobile OSes. To see the handful of commands that make up the protocol please check out the readme on the code page. We will gladly accept contributions of the protocol implemented on other OSes.

Reference client implementations:
RLCD - Android App providing virtual remote LCD.
rlcd_client.py - Python RLCD client demo.
rlcd_client.sh - BASH RLCD client utility.
rlcd_uidemo_spark_core.ino - Interactive UI demo for Spark Core.
